Google Analytics.

Our website uses third party Google Analytics, a web analysis service of Google, Inc. (“Google”). Google Analytics is a simple, easy-to-use tool that helps website owners measure how users interact with website content. As a user navigates between web pages, Google Analytics provides website owners JavaScript tags (libraries) to record information about the page a user has seen, for example the URL of the page. Google Analytics collect following data: time of visit, pages visited, and time spent on each page of the webpages, referring site details (such as the URI a user came through to arrive at this site), type of web browser, type of operating system (OS), flash version, JavaScript support, screen resolution, and screen color processing ability, network location and IP address, document downloads, clicks on links leading to external websites, errors when users fill out forms, clicks on videos, scroll depth, interactions with site-specific widgets. Google Analytics collects information in an anonymous form, including the number of visitors to the site, where visitors have come to the site from, the pages they visited and the features they used.
